为什么服务器能存储那么多的数据呢,揭秘大数据时代,服务器如何实现海量数据存储
- 综合资讯
- 2024-10-23 08:12:53
- 2

在数据爆炸的今天,服务器通过采用分布式存储技术、高速读写磁盘、数据压缩与去重等手段,实现海量数据的高效存储。云计算与虚拟化技术也助力于扩展存储容量,满足大数据时代的数据...
在数据爆炸的今天,服务器通过采用分布式存储技术、高速读写磁盘、数据压缩与去重等手段,实现海量数据的高效存储。云计算与虚拟化技术也助力于扩展存储容量,满足大数据时代的数据存储需求。
随着互联网技术的飞速发展,大数据时代已经来临,在这个时代,数据已经成为企业的核心资产,而服务器作为数据存储的重要载体,其存储能力的高低直接关系到企业的竞争力和发展潜力,为什么服务器能存储那么多的数据呢?本文将从以下几个方面进行探讨。
服务器硬件升级
1、存储容量提升
随着硬盘技术的不断进步,硬盘的存储容量也在不断提升,目前,市面上的硬盘容量已经达到了TB级别,甚至有企业推出了PB级硬盘,这使得服务器在存储大量数据方面具备了强大的硬件基础。
2、处理器性能增强
服务器的处理器性能也在不断提升,这使得服务器在处理海量数据时,速度更快、效率更高,采用多核处理器的服务器可以同时处理多个任务,从而提高数据存储和处理能力。
3、内存容量增加
内存是服务器处理数据的重要载体,内存容量的大小直接影响着服务器的性能,随着内存技术的不断发展,服务器内存容量也在不断增加,使得服务器在存储和处理数据时更加高效。
数据压缩技术
1、算法优化
数据压缩技术是提高数据存储密度的关键,通过对数据进行压缩,可以大幅度减少存储空间的需求,目前,服务器普遍采用各种数据压缩算法,如LZ77、LZ78、Huffman编码等,以提高数据存储效率。
2、数据去重
在存储大量数据时,数据去重技术可以有效地减少重复数据的存储空间,通过比对数据之间的相似度,服务器可以识别出重复数据,并将其删除或合并,从而降低存储需求。
分布式存储技术
1、数据分片
分布式存储技术可以将大量数据分散存储在多个服务器上,从而提高数据存储的可靠性和扩展性,数据分片技术将数据划分为多个小片段,分别存储在各个服务器上,当需要访问数据时,服务器之间可以协同工作,共同完成数据访问任务。
2、存储冗余
分布式存储技术通常采用存储冗余策略,如RAID(独立冗余磁盘阵列)技术,以保证数据在单个服务器出现故障时,不会丢失,通过增加存储冗余,服务器可以存储更多的数据。
云存储技术
1、弹性扩展
云存储技术可以实现按需扩展存储空间,企业可以根据实际需求购买相应的存储资源,这种弹性扩展能力使得服务器可以轻松应对海量数据的存储需求。
2、数据备份与恢复
云存储平台通常具备完善的数据备份与恢复机制,可以保证数据的安全性,在数据发生丢失或损坏时,企业可以迅速恢复数据,降低数据损失风险。
服务器之所以能存储那么多的数据,主要得益于硬件升级、数据压缩技术、分布式存储技术和云存储技术等方面的进步,随着技术的不断发展,服务器存储能力将不断提高,为大数据时代的到来提供有力保障。
本文链接:https://www.zhitaoyun.cn/273557.html
发表评论